    CAGI Performance Verification

    Third-party verified compressor performance data - the industry standard for spec sheets

    ISO 8573-1 Air Quality Classes

    Defines allowable particulate, water, and oil content for compressed air (Classes 0-9)

    ASME Section VIII

    Pressure vessel code for air receivers and after-coolers

    NIOSH / OSHA 29 CFR 1910.134

    Breathing air quality requirements for respirator use

    CAGI Performance Verification knowledge matters because it's the basis for every compressor spec sheet in the industry. ISO 8573-1 air quality classes matter for food, pharma, and electronics applications. OSHA 29 CFR 1910.134 breathing air standards matter for any facility with respirator programs. Beyond formal certifications, hands-on controller experience is what separates candidates: Elektronikon, Intellisys, SIGMA CONTROL, SUPERVISOR, and AirLogic are the platforms hiring managers ask about by name.

    That's normal in compressed air. A technician trained on Kaeser screw compressors can work on Sullair or Atlas Copco units. The fundamentals transfer: air ends, oil systems, controls, dryers, filtration. We evaluate transferable skills across OEM lines because that's how the industry actually works. We also know which OEM-specific skills don't transfer cleanly (centrifugal is different from rotary screw, oil-free is different from oil-injected) and we screen for that.
